Why waterproof flooring?

 
Anytime moisture is left to pool on flooring that isn’t waterproof, it will eventually seep into the core where it can do extensive damage. Expansion of the material can cause bulging, warping and separation of your flooring parts. This, in turn, can lead to mold and mildew which can be very damaging to the health of your family.

When your flooring is impervious to any kind of water damage, not only can you clean up spills at your leisure, without worry of impending damage, but you can truly breathe better, knowing your family is safe.
